Output e18cfc299f0e78ce37845a177be863a7d9e74f398cdc5cbff843c8562669c525:1

value
16975830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d98d9ade5ae4479b992e68a81ba2ee3c75c8e2 OP_EQUAL
address
3LpbmVbL6uaN2rgGbu8nLVarKf5PLr8UM6
transaction
e18cfc299f0e78ce37845a177be863a7d9e74f398cdc5cbff843c8562669c525
spent
true